Several factors influence the total cost of a rental. First, the type of unit matters; a standard portable toilet is more budget-friendly than a luxury restroom trailer with climate control or flushing capabilities. Delivery distance from our local hub also plays a part, as does the frequency of cleaning required for longer jobs. Professional rental services handle the delivery, setup, and regular maintenance of portable sanitation units. You need these services when hosting outdoor gatherings, managing construction crews, or planning community events where permanent plumbing is unavailable. The team ensures units are stocked, pumped, and sanitized on a set schedule so your site remains clean and functional for all users throughout your event or project timeline.
